Mangawhero Falls

Ruapehu

The Mangawhero Falls are well-signposted just before you reach the forest margin of Ruapehu. You can step down to the river and the top of the falls from the parking area off Ohakune Mountain Road. Take care near the edge, as it’s a 28-metre drop! You can also walk around the cliff edge, protected by a fence and fringed by beech trees, to a viewing point, looking back at the falls.

Although the water flow is modest when it’s dry, the combination of cliffs, an overhang of beech trees and mountain shrubs, and the red rock behind the falls makes it a very photogenic location. The spring melt is probably the best time to see a stronger water flow.

The pool below the falls is also known as Golem’s Pool for LOTR fans.
